Zusammenfassung:In RFID field, it is easy to interfere between adjacent channels as the frequency band and channel bandwidth are narrow. Especially, in case of the dense reader mode where the number of readers is more than the number of channels, the readers easily collide with each other. In this paper, we propose an algorithm to avoid reader collision in dense reader environment. First, we introduce the operation of our algorithm. And next, we show the simulation results of the proposed algorithm. Simulation results show performance improvement of our algorithm compared to existing LBT algorithm.
